Trump supported Orban, who is trying to win the election on anti-Ukrainian rhetoric


The current head of the Hungarian government is “a truly strong and influential leader with a proven track record of achieving phenomenal results,” including in relations with Washington, Trump wrote in Truth Social.

“Hungary: come out and vote for Viktor Orban. He is a true friend, a fighter and a winner, and he has my full and unconditional support for re-election as Prime Minister of Hungary,” the head of the White House urged, noting that he remains with the prime minister “all the way.”

Earlier, a similar statement was made by the head of the Israeli government, Benjamin Netanyahu. In an address to the Conference of Conservative Political Forces in Budapest, he said that Orban “is stability, safety and security.” Netanyahu also thanked the Hungarian government for allegedly “defending Western civilization from the wave of radical, fanatical Muslims.”

Polish Foreign Minister Radoslaw Sikorski announced on March 21 that Polish President Karol Nawrocki intends to publicly support Orban in the parliamentary elections.
